Transaction 59584fb9b679034ab03930d950fee6da70353d2c08e1224bd93018f66cc115dc
1 Input
1 Output
-
59584fb9b679034ab03930d950fee6da70353d2c08e1224bd93018f66cc115dc:0
- value
- 151230
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8615ca836dd03f00b0a8d9c9d763bf35826b7b38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DDyemxqqqHRTJuYtL1EKVWEuNsEwJS98c